GeotrekCE / Geotrek-admin

Paths management for National Parks and Tourism organizations
https://geotrek.fr
BSD 2-Clause "Simplified" License
131 stars 75 forks source link

Uniformisation de l'échelle verticale des profils altimétriques #3706

Open leplatrem opened 1 year ago

leplatrem commented 1 year ago

En surfant sur les nouveautés (👏 ), j'ai été surpris par certains profils altimétriques, dont l'échelle n'est pas homogène entre les différents supports (eg. widget vs. PDF).

Les règles de calcul de l'échelle verticale en fonction des min et max n'ont pas l'air d'etre les memes partout. Et comme l'echelle verticale varie d'un trek a l'autre, si on fait pas attention, on peut avoir l'avoir impression d'avoir à franchir des sommets dans le Jura!

Une idée de solution serait de determiner (ou configurer) les min/max de l'échelle verticale pour l'ensemble du parc, en l'applicant sur tous les supports.

echelle qui rend le profile "nepalien"

Screenshot 2023-09-08 at 10 18 15

echelle plus realiste sur un autre trek?

Screenshot 2023-09-08 at 10 25 24

echelle manquante

Screenshot 2023-09-08 at 10 18 41

plat qui tronque le graphe

Screenshot 2023-09-08 at 10 18 59 Screenshot 2023-09-08 at 10 19 16

minimum a zero versus a min(trek)

Screenshot 2023-09-08 at 10 21 59 Screenshot 2023-09-08 at 10 22 09
camillemonchicourt commented 1 year ago

Ouais bien vu. Tu avais bossé sur le sujet côté Geotrek-admin (https://github.com/GeotrekCE/Geotrek-admin/issues/1155) Je pense que ceux qui posent le plus de soucis sont ceux affichés en jaune, qui est le nouveau widget Geotrek-rando. Vu ici - https://www.jurabsolu.fr/geotrek/?trek=3156 et ici - https://www.jurabsolu.fr/geotrek/?trek=3157

Donc je pense que c'est surtout au niveau du widget qu'il faudrait revoir ce sujet, car côté Geotrek-admin (en orange), ça me semble mieux car on avait pas mal creusé le sujet.

Il faudrait voir ce que ça donne sur Geotrek-rando, mais je trouve pas de Geotrek-rando de ces randos.

Mais en regardant chez nous, côté Geotrek-rando, il semble y avoir les mêmes soucis que sur Geotrek-rando-widget. Si je regarde cette petite rando plate, sur Geotrek-rando c'est pas cohérent : https://geotrek-admin.ecrins-parcnational.fr/api/fr/treks/919374/larchitecture-du-puy.pdf?portal=1 Sur Geotrek-admin, c'est mieux : https://geotrek-admin.ecrins-parcnational.fr/api/fr/treks/919374/larchitecture-du-puy.pdf?portal=1

Sinon la piste d'avoir un mix et max par instance est intéressante, et serait certainement la meilleure solution pour avoir des profils homogènes entre randos et adaptés au type de territoire.

babastienne commented 1 year ago

Vaste sujet les profils altimétriques.

Déjà pour ma part je suis pas très fan des profils altimétriques générés en image. Ca manque clairement d'interactivité côté Geotrek-Admin et c'est un peu passé de mode.

Dans la configuration par défaut de Geotrek-Admin le minimum affiché en altitude c'est 1200m, et pour la majeur partie des territoires en France c'est trop élevé ce qui signifie que le profil altimétrique est tout plat et donc ne sert à rien. En fait c'est surtout que le rapport au dénivelé n'est pas le même en fonction des territoires, car dans les écrins une randonnée avec 300m de dénivelé c'est une randonnée plate mais pour d'autres régions c'est une rando difficile sur laquelle il faut mettre en évidence le dénivelé.

Côté Geotrek-Admin il y a pas mal de paramètres pour adapter les profils altimétrique, c'est cool : image

Par contre côté Geotrek-Rando et Widget c'est pas le cas. Le plugin utilisé ne permet pas de modifier l'échelle de l'axe Y, ce qui fait que pour éviter les mini-rando qui semblent être des montagnes gigantesques la solution trouvée a été de tout simplement ne pas afficher le profil altimétrique en dessous d'un certain dénivelé.

Si on veut corriger le problème sur widget et rando il faudrait soit trouver un autre plugin d'altimétrie soit contribuer pour l'améliorer.

Avoir un min et max par instance je sais pas si c'est pertinent parce que je suppose que pour certains grands territoires ça risque de pas avoir beaucoup de sens ? (grand département, région).

Un autre problème sur les profils altimétriques dans Geotrek-Rando c'est leur aspect saccadé en escalier parfois :

image

Bref y a du boulot pour homogénéiser tout ça, au moins on est d'accord sur le constat :smile: